Ideas for Layering Tops Japanese Season Sōkō – Frost Descent

Ideas for Layering Tops: Japanese Season Sōkō – Frost Descent

October 20, 2023

I'm still not used to the fact that autumn is here, and October is mostly over! But I love autumn clothes, so that helps me adjust...

Today I'm thinking about how we have to layer up a LOT of clothes first thing in the morning (I wear gloves any time the temp is below 55 Fahrenheit!), but by afternoon we can peel off at least 1 layer...

In the past, I've called this the "Triple Top Secret" because having three tops that work together give you at least a half-dozen different combinations... Pack 3 tops and an extra pair of pants, and you're good for a long weekend!

Your "pivot" top - the one around which you build - can be your 2nd layer, as I've shown here:
